This tea is considered one of the elite of Japanese teas, and it is customary to drink it little by little and slowly. The Japanese call it “Tea for Geniuses.” Gyokuro is the highest grade of Japanese tea Tea recognized as one of the best Japanese teas.

What is the secret of this tea? Consider the production management. The leaves are collected by hand in early spring. The whole point of this process is that a few weeks before the harvest, at the time of the active growth of the first buds, canopies are built over the tea plantation and gradually shade the space.

This way the growth process slows down, and the leaves retain their tenderness, sweetness and usefulness.
